Theme 1: Understanding the Core of Marketing Automation

会员营销新玩法:HubSpot AI智能分层与权益推送-1

Marketing automation is not about replacing human creativity with robots. Instead, it is about using technology to nurture leads, personalize communication, and save precious time. Hubspot emphasizes the "flywheel" model, which shifts focus from traditional funnel thinking to a circular system where delighted customers become promoters. For small businesses, this means every email, social post, or landing page should be designed to attract, engage, and delight. According to Hubspot, companies that automate lead management see a 10% or more increase in revenue within 6-9 months. The key is to start small: automate your welcome emails, segment your contact lists based on behavior, and create workflows that trigger follow-up messages automatically. This foundational step ensures no lead falls through the cracks, and you can focus your energy on high-value tasks like product development and strategic partnerships.

Theme 2: Personalization at Scale with Data-Driven Insights

One of the biggest misconceptions is that personalization requires a massive team. Hubspot teaches us that even a two-person marketing team can achieve personalization at scale by utilizing smart content and behavioral triggers. For example, if a visitor downloads your pricing guide but never signs up for a demo, an automated workflow can send a targeted case study three days later. This is not just about using the customer’s first name; it’s about delivering relevant content based on where they are in the buyer’s journey. Hubspot’s analytics tools allow you to track email open rates, click-through rates, and page views, giving you a clear picture of what resonates with your audience. By regularly reviewing these metrics, you can refine your messaging and avoid the cookie-cutter approach that drives customers away. Remember, a personalized experience feels like a conversation, not a broadcast.

Theme 3: Lead Scoring and Prioritization – Focus on the Right Prospects

Not all leads are created equal. Some are ready to buy, while others are still researching. Hubspot emphasizes the importance of lead scoring, which assigns points to contacts based on their actions and demographic fit. For instance, a lead who visits your pricing page five times and downloads a whitepaper should score higher than someone who only opened a newsletter. By setting up automated scoring rules, you can prioritize your sales team’s efforts on the hottest prospects. This is not just about efficiency; it’s about revenue generation. Hubspot reports that companies using lead scoring see a 77% increase in ROI. For small businesses, this means you stop wasting time on tire-kickers and start closing deals faster. Implement a basic scoring model: positive actions (like requesting a quote) add points, while negative actions (like unsubscribing) subtract points. This simple system can dramatically improve your conversion rates.

Theme 4: Content Automation – Turn Your Blog into a Lead Machine

Your blog is your most powerful asset, but only if you use it strategically. Hubspot’s approach to content automation involves repurposing and scheduling. Instead of writing a new article every day, create one comprehensive "cornerstone" piece and then break it down into multiple social media posts, email newsletters, and short videos. Use automation tools to schedule these across different channels at optimal times. Moreover, implement a simple call-to-action in every blog post, such as a free template or checklist, and automate the delivery of that resource. This transforms passive readers into active leads. Hubspot’s data shows that businesses that blog 16 times per month get 3.5 times more traffic than those that blog four times or less. But quality trumps quantity – every post should solve a specific problem for your target audience. By automating the distribution, you ensure consistency without burning out your team.

Theme 5: Measuring Success – The Metrics That Matter

Finally, you cannot improve what you do not measure. Hubspot advocates for focusing on a few key performance indicators (KPIs) rather than drowning in data. For small businesses, the essential metrics are: marketing qualified leads (MQLs), conversion rate from lead to customer, customer acquisition cost, and customer lifetime value. Automate your reporting by creating dashboards that update in real-time. This allows you to spot trends quickly – for instance, if a particular email sequence is driving high engagement, you can double down on it. Conversely, if a landing page has a high bounce rate, you can test new headlines or designs. Hubspot’s philosophy is that marketing is a continuous loop of testing, learning, and optimizing. Never set and forget; instead, schedule monthly reviews of your automation workflows to ensure they align with your current business goals.
